What to Expect from a Private Psychiatrist Assessment
The assessment procedure with a private psychiatrist can differ based upon individual requirements and the psychiatrist's technique. Nevertheless, there are generally accepted steps in this process:
Initial Consultation: This very first conference will usually involve a consumption process. Patients will discuss their case history, existing signs, and specific issues they want to address.
Extensive Evaluation: The psychiatrist may carry out a complete psychosocial assessment that covers individual life, family history, and ecological aspects that might impact mental health.
Evaluating and Assessment Tools: Depending on the initial findings, the psychiatrist may utilize various screening tools or psychological tests to get more insight into the client's mental health.
Feedback Session: After evaluating the information from both the initial consultation and any carried out evaluations, the psychiatrist will offer feedback to the client, often including a diagnosis (if suitable).
Treatment Recommendations: Following the assessment, the psychiatrist will go over potential treatment choices, which can range from talk treatment to medication management.
Follow-Up Appointments: Patients may be motivated to arrange follow-up appointments to keep track of symptoms and change treatment strategies as needed.

4. How long does an assessment take?
The length of an assessment can vary, however generally ranges from 60 to 120 minutes depending upon the intricacy of the case and the scope of examination.
